Personal Comments:
Problems in our lives occur despite our best efforts to avoid them. When they happen, we can find ourselves overwhelmed, and our most valued relationships in distress.
The good news is that it doesn't have to be this way. Men and women who have learned to effectively access their endowed internal resources while using situationally-appropriate interpersonal skills are better able to lead empowered, informed and healthy lives.
I work extensively with men and women who have experienced repetitive patterns of failure in their love and/or work relationships. Using a highly individualized interactive process, I team with individuals and/or couples to help work toward overcoming those patterns and move into a greater measure of personal wellness and interpersonal success.
Because I believe your circumstance should be weighed on its own unique merits, I do not offer "cookie-cutter" therapy or assembly-line solutions. Depending upon your specifics, recommended therapy may include individual work, couples therapy, group therapy, gender-balanced work with a female therapist, or a combination of these.
Licensed as a Marriage & Family Therapist, I hold a Ph.D. in Psychology with a specialization in Health Psychology. I hold a M.A. in Counseling Psychology and a M.Div. in Pastoral Studies. I also have a Certificate of Professional Studies in Clinical Psychophysiology, and am trained in EMDR. I divide my professional time between my practice, clinical research on sexuality, and conducting professional workshops and therapeutic retreats.

General Comments:
I work extensively with sexuality and relationship concerns involving male sexual problems, female sexual dysfunction, compulsive sex ("sex addiction"), repeated patterns of relationship failure, extramarital affairs, adult survivors of childhood sexual abuse, and sexual identity issues. I also help those who are struggling with the impact of cancer, chronic illness and/or lifestyle illness such as diabetes, cardiovascular disease, hypertension, and sexually-transmitted diseases.
